> Thanks for the support provided by you guys. I am able to run
> the application using runas.exe but it does not allows me to
> provide the domain password with the same command. Could you
> please provide me a solution to provide password with it.

use runas with /savecred the first time, and then it'll run without
prompting you for the password.
